How should the AVGO historical PE ratio be determined?
Realizing that PE stands for Price to Earnings ratio, we need two values to compute it: stock price and earnings per share. The stock price at any given date is a known historical value, but what about the earnings number to use?

✔️Accepted answer: There are a number of different approaches when it comes to calculating a historical PE ratio for a company like Broadcom. We like to take our measurements on each of the past quarterly earnings reports. That only leaves the question of whether the earnings number at that quarterly report should be used on an annualized basis, or some other method. We approach this question using three different methods, on this AVGO Historical PE Ratio page.

What is the average historical PE for AVGO based on annualized quarterly earnings?
As we look back through earnings history, what is the resulting PE calculation if at each measurement period we use that quarter's earnings result annualized?

✔️Accepted answer: The AVGO historical PE ratio using the annualized quarterly earnings method works out to 15.2.

What is the average historical PE for AVGO based on trailing twelve month earnings?
As we look back through earnings history, what is the resulting PE calculation if at each measurement period we use the trailing twelve months combined earnings result in the calculation?

✔️Accepted answer: The AVGO historical PE ratio using the TTM earnings method works out to 16.6.

What is the average historical PE for AVGO based on median TTM earnings?
As we look back through earnings history, what is the resulting PE calculation if at each measurement period we use the median earnings over the trailing twelve months and annualize that median result in the calculation?

✔️Accepted answer: The AVGO historical PE ratio using the annualized median TTM earnings method works out to 43.08.

On this page we presented the Broadcom Historical PE Ratio information for Broadcom' stock. The average AVGO historical PE based on using the annualized quarterly earnings result at each measurement period (for the "E" in the PE calculation; and the closing price on earnings date as the "P") is 15.2. Meanwhile, using the trailing twelve month (TTM) quarterly earnings result as our method of calculation the "E" value at each measurement period, the average AVGO historical PE based on this TTM earnings result method is 16.6.

Let's now compare this AVGO historical PE result, against the recent PE: when this page was posted on 3/8/2024, the most recent closing price for AVGO had been 1308.72, and the most recent quarterly earnings result, annualized, was 43.96. Meanwhile, the most recent TTM earnings summed to 42.91. From these numbers, we calculate the recent AVGO PE on 3/8/2024 based on annualized quarterly EPS was 29.8. Based on AVGO's history, that recent PE is elevated relative to the historical average, with the recent PE 96.1% higher than the historical average PE across our data set for Broadcom. Looking at the recent AVGO PE on 3/8/2024 based on TTM EPS, we calculate the ratio at 30.5. Based on AVGO's history, that recent PE is elevated relative to the historical average, with the recent PE 83.7% higher than the historical average PE across our Broadcom data set with TTM EPS used in the calculation at each period.

Another interesting AVGO historical PE Ratio calculation we look at is to take the median earnings per share of the last four quarters for AVGO, and then annualize the resulting value... with that annualized number then being used in the PE calculation. To walk through this math for AVGO, we start with the past four EPS numbers and we first sort them from lowest to highest: 10.32, 10.54, 10.99, and 11.06. We then toss out the highest and lowest result, and then take the average of those two middle numbers — 10.54 and 10.99 — which gives us the median of 10.77. Basically the way to think about this 10.77 number is this: for the trailing four earnings reports, 10.77 marks the "middle ground" number where AVGO has reported a value higher than 10.77 half the time, and has reported a value lower than 10.77 half the time. Annualizing that median value then gets us to 43.08/share, which we use as the denominator in our next PE calculation. With 1308.72 as the numerator (as of 3/8/2024), the calculation is then 1308.72 / 43.08 = 30.4 as the AVGO PE ratio as of 3/8/2024, based on that annualized median value we calculated.
